Yann Frisch returns to Le Carré with a new creation that sits at the intersection of theater and magic. Embracing the realm of the fantastic, he sweeps us into his vortex and—through the story of a couple—examines our relationship with reality and the invisible. It is a unique experience that challenges the boundaries and limits of our own perceptions.

From theater and cinema to *magie nouvelle* (contemporary magic), Yann Frisch holds a distinctive place in the performing arts world. With his company, L’Absente, he designed a traveling truck-tent—a sort of cocoon—to house his productions. After a stop at Le Carré that delighted (and astonished) audiences with *Le Paradoxe de Georges*, Yann Frisch returns to the stage with a new play bringing together two people who love each other—quite simply—yet seem worlds apart.

Clémence, a psychoanalyst, is played by Anne Rotger—known for her film roles in Justine Triet’s *Anatomy of a Fall*, Sandrine Kiberlain’s *A Radiant Girl*, and Noémie Lvovsky’s *The Great Magic*. André, a philosophy professor, is portrayed by Jérôme Kircher, an actor with a rich background in theater (Wajdi Mouawad, Guy Cassiers, Amos Gitaï), cinema (Jean-Pierre Jeunet, Laetitia Masson, Eric Lartigau), and television (Josée Dayan). The couple’s story is upended when Clémence begins experiencing visions and hallucinations. Is it a mystical delusion? A supra-sensory experience? Driven by powerful magical effects, this is a compelling work that blurs the line between the visible and the invisible, challenging our sensory certainties.
